Where can I find a description of what the Loaded templates are compared to the standard templates?

Many thanks.

Hi Melanie,

The loaded packages are full Joomla installations while the templates are just the templates. The new versions of the loaded packages are called quick start packages and install in the same way that you would normally install Joomla on your server.

I hate to seem so dense, but I'm new to Joomla. Does the loaded version include database definitions and sample data in addition to the structure? Anything else? If I already have data entered, would the installation of the loaded package overlay this data? Or would it create a new database altogether?

Thank you again for your beautiful templates. Perhaps you could include a tutorial walking newbies through the process of the loaded installation process.

Hi Melanie,

Glad to have you aboard :)

Which template are you looking at using. We are in between moving the quick start packages from an old technique to a new technique. The answer will depend on the template you want to use.

Generally though the quickstart packages are full installations of Joomla as per the demo site. The new version will be setup in the usual ay that you upload and install Joomla on your server.

Part of the work we are doing is building a dedicated tutorial area also.
